A lot of people ITT don't understand that for a male haircut to be a thing it almost definitely has to be short and low maintenance and interpretable/flexible enough to be worn by everyone
Stuff like Lax/hockey bro hair and mullets are pretty specific to white people tbh, and they take a while to grow out. HY achieved the mainstream trendiness/"thing" that it did because it's something easily attainable and relatively low maintenance, even people with really curly hair can just shave the sides really tight and have a HY

another thing which makes the mullet a generally accessible hairstyle is the ability to have the top and sides cut in a way that will suit your face shape while letting the back grow.
but still, as with the manbun, you have to have a good profile or the mullet will just accentuate a weak chin or jaw by adding more mass to the back of the head. pic related lol
>>9753992
that's not really a mullet. a mullet is generally a lot longer in the back than on the top or sides. like joe dirt says, business in the front, party in the back
